大家好,今天小編關(guān)注到一個比較有意思的話題,就是關(guān)于自動化測試平臺推薦的問題,于是小編就整理了4個相關(guān)介紹自動化測試平臺推薦的解答,讓我們一起看看吧。
1、北大青鳥j*a培訓:自動化測試常用工具有哪些?
負載壓力測試工具這類測試工具的主要目的是度量應用系統(tǒng)的可擴展性和性能,是一種預測系統(tǒng)行為和性能的自動化測試工具。
WinRunner是一種企業(yè)級的功能測試工具,用于檢測應用程序是否能夠達到預期的功能及正常運行。
白盒測試白盒測試也稱為結(jié)構(gòu)測試,是根據(jù)程序內(nèi)部的邏輯結(jié)構(gòu)和***碼結(jié)構(gòu),設計測試數(shù)據(jù),完成測試的測試方***。白盒子測試的直接優(yōu)點是,知***所設計的測試用例在***碼上的哪個地方被忽視。
支持參數(shù)化。robotframework優(yōu)點關(guān)鍵字驅(qū)動,自定義用戶關(guān)鍵字。支持測試日志和報告生成。支持系統(tǒng)關(guān)鍵字開發(fā),可擴展性好。支持數(shù)據(jù)庫操作。缺點接口測試用例寫起來不簡潔。需要掌握特定語***。
cucumber是BDD(Beh*ior-drivendevelopment,行為驅(qū)動開發(fā))的一個自動化測試的副產(chǎn)品。它使用自然語言來描述測試,使得非程序員可以理解他們。Gherkin是這種自然語言測試的簡單語***,而Cucumber是可以執(zhí)行它們的工具。
2、python自動化測試框架有哪些
自動化測試常用的Python框架有哪些?常用的框架有Robot Framework、Pytest、UnitTest/PyUnit、Beh*e、Lettuce。Pytest、Robot Framework和UnitTest主要用于功能與單元測試,Lettuce和Beh*e僅適用于行為驅(qū)動測試。
python測試框架Beh*e允許團隊避開各種復雜的情況,去執(zhí)行BDD測試。從本質(zhì)上說該框架與SpecFlow和Cucumber相似,常被用于執(zhí)行自動化測試。用戶可以通過簡單易讀的語言來編寫測試用例,并能夠在其執(zhí)行期間粘貼到***碼之中。
好象python的瀏覽器測試框架,原來只有一個,還是仿ruby的框架做的。似乎在IE上可以比較好的應用。很老的框架。對JS支持不好。不過python寫個測試框架真是非常容易的事情,隨手就來。 基于瀏覽器測試也容易做。
用python做自動化測試,主要是接口測試和UI自動化測試。接口測試:**協(xié)議的舉例:可以用python自帶的urllib\urllib2模擬,模擬前端向服務器發(fā)送數(shù)據(jù),獲取返回值后,進行校驗和判斷來進行接口測試。
3、軟件開發(fā)的自動化測試工具有什么好用的推薦?
常用的工具有:Selenium:這是一個用于Web應用程序的自動化測試工具,可以模擬用戶操作如點擊、輸入等。***ium:這是一個移動應用自動化測試框架,支持iOS和Android平臺。
常用的性能測試工具有LoadRunner、Gatling、Tsung等。這些工具可以模擬大量用戶并發(fā)訪問系統(tǒng)的場景,對系統(tǒng)進行壓力測試,以評估系統(tǒng)的性能表現(xiàn)。自動化測試工具:這類工具主要用于自動化執(zhí)行測試用例,提高測試效率和準確性。
眾安科技的質(zhì)量中臺DevCube M*ic是企業(yè)級智能全場景持續(xù)測試平臺,涵蓋***碼靜態(tài)掃描、接口自動化測試、UI自動化測試、性能測試、流量錄制與回放、用例管理和測試**管理等功能,助力企業(yè)高質(zhì)量持續(xù)交付軟件產(chǎn)品。
常用的軟件測試工具包括:Bug管理系統(tǒng):如JIRA、Bugzilla等,用于跟蹤和管理缺陷。測試管理工具:如TestRail、QC(Quality Center)等,用于管理測試用例、**和執(zhí)行結(jié)果。
企業(yè)級自動化測試工具WinRunner,用于檢測應用程序是否能夠達到預期的功能及正常運行。
4、不可不知的十大軟件測試工具
安全測試工具:這類工具主要用于測試軟件的安全性,包括漏洞掃描、***碼審計等方面。常用的安全測試工具有Nmap、Wireshark、OWASP Zap等。這些工具可以幫助安全人員檢測軟件中存在的安全漏洞和隱患,并提供修復建議和解決方案。
WinRunner Winrunner 最主要的功能是自動重復執(zhí)行某一固定的測試過程,它以腳本的形式記錄下手工測試的一系列操作,在環(huán)境相同的情況下重放,檢查其在相同的環(huán)境中有無異常的現(xiàn)象或與預期結(jié)果不符的地方。
企業(yè)級自動化測試工具WinRunner,用于檢測應用程序是否能夠達到預期的功能及正常運行。
Ranorex Studio;不僅是一個跨瀏覽器的測試工具,而且還可以作為web應用程序的一體化解決方案,允許用戶自動測試各種各樣的技術(shù)和框架。
到此,以上就是小編對于自動化測試平臺推薦的問題就介紹到這了,希望介紹關(guān)于自動化測試平臺推薦的4點解答對大家有用。